The age and sex structure of a population may be described by a

A
Life table
B
Correlation coefficient
C
Population pyramid
D
Bar chart
High-Yield Explanation
Population pyramid: (age-sex pyramid or age-structure diagram) Is a graphical illustration that shows the distribution of various age groups in a population which normally forms the shape of a pyramid – Double Histogram: 2 back-to-back histogram graphs 1. one showing the number of males and 2. one showing females in a particular population (Males are conventionally shown on left and females on right) – The population (%) is plotted on the X-axis and age on the Y-axis (in 5-year age group intervals)
